AI-Generated Summary

This episode of ABC News Daily examines the escalating controversy surrounding Donald Trump's recent behavior, particularly his public attacks on Pope Leo and the controversial AI-generated image of himself as a Christ-like figure. The discussion centers on whether Trump's increasingly erratic social media outbursts—especially those targeting the Pope and threatening the destruction of Iran—signal a deeper crisis in his mental fitness to lead, especially during a time of international conflict. David A Graham from The Atlantic provides context, tracing Trump's pattern of late-night social media rants that begin on Sundays and escalate into tirades against political opponents, religious figures, and global leaders. The episode explores how Trump's use of religious imagery for political gain contrasts sharply with his dismissal of religious doctrine, raising questions about authenticity and psychological stability. Despite widespread concern from both political opponents and some within his own coalition, including figures like Marjorie Taylor Greene and Tucker Carlson, there remains little indication that Trump's inner circle is distancing itself, making the invocation of the 25th Amendment highly unlikely. The Pope’s calm, principled response—emphasizing peace and faith without direct confrontation—stands in stark contrast to Trump’s provocations. The episode underscores a growing national and international debate: whether a leader’s mental state should be a legitimate concern when they hold the power to initiate war. While Trump’s defenders argue he is merely keeping opponents off balance, critics point to a consistent pattern of instability, including the AI image, threats of genocide, and a lack of coherent foreign policy. The discussion concludes with a sober assessment that while Trump’s behavior is alarming, the institutional mechanisms to remove him remain nearly impossible to activate. The episode serves as a cautionary tale about the intersection of religion, power, and mental health in modern leadership.
